What is Gemini Gems?

Let’s clear up exactly what a Gem actually is, because the marketing name doesn’t really do it justice. You can think of a standard AI like a brilliant, temporary assistant. Every time you open a new chat window, you are starting from scratch. You have spent the first five minutes re-explaining who you are, what your brand voice sounds like, what formatting style you prefer, and which cliches to avoid.
